Lawns are ubiquitous in the American urban landscapes. However, little is known about their impact on the carbon and water cycles at the national level. The limited information on the total extent and spatial distribution of these ecosystems and the variability in management practices are the major factors complicating this assessment. Perennial ryegrass is one of the most commonly cultivated forage species in Europe, where grazing and mowing (cutting) are used to manage this resource. Cutting can be characterized by its intensity (height) and its frequency.
